EPP board nominates Tomasz Trzósło to succeed Hadley Dean as CEO

17th December 2019

By: Simone Liedtke

Creamer Media Social Media Editor & Senior Writer

     

Font size: - +

The board of directors of property company EPP has nominated Tomasz Trzósło for appointment as CEO to succeed Hadley Dean, whose term of office is due to expire.

Trzósło is expected to assume his role in May 2020, but it is subject to approval by the general meeting of shareholders.

Trzósło is expected to join EPP from property and investment company JLL where he serves as the managing director for Poland and Central Europe. He has held various senior leadership positions in the company and participated in numerous capital markets transactions including real estate sales, acquisitions and equity raising projects, a statement on Tuesday said.

Speaking on the nomination, EPP chairperson Robert Weisz said that the company is looking forward to welcoming Trzósło to the company, and “look forward to working with him to further accelerate our efforts in ensuring EPP’s long term growth”.
